Why These Are the Top Insulation Contractors in Clarksville

** The insulation market serving Clarksville, Iowa, is characterized by a small number of highly specialized local and regional contractors. Due to the city's size and rural nature, there are no insulation companies physically located within Clarksville's city limits. Therefore, residents typically rely on established providers from nearby commercial hubs like Cedar Falls, Waverly, and Mason City. The competition among these top-tier providers is strong, driving a high standard of quality and customer service. The average quality of service is excellent, as these companies survive by building strong reputations across a wide service area. They are well-versed in Iowa's climate challenges, local building codes, and available energy efficiency rebates from utilities like Alliant Energy. Typical pricing is competitive but can vary significantly based on the project scope and insulation type. For a standard attic blow-in with cellulose, homeowners might expect to pay between $1,500 - $3,000. More advanced solutions like spray foam insulation for a crawl space or rim joists can range from $2,500 to $5,000 or more, reflecting the higher material cost and technical expertise required. It is standard practice in this market to obtain multiple free estimates.

Frequently Asked Questions About Insulation in Clarksville

Get answers to common questions about insulation services in Clarksville, Iowa.

1What are the most important types of insulation for my Clarksville home, given Iowa's climate?

For our harsh Iowa winters and humid summers, a layered approach is key. We highly recommend air sealing combined with attic insulation (typically blown-in cellulose or fiberglass to achieve R-49 to R-60) and properly insulated basement or crawlspace walls. This combats significant heat loss in winter and moisture intrusion in summer, which is crucial for comfort and preventing issues like ice dams.

2How much does insulation installation typically cost for a home in the Clarksville area?

Costs vary based on home size, insulation type, and areas serviced, but local projects for a standard attic often range from $1,500 to $3,500. Whole-house upgrades (attic, walls, basement) can range from $4,000 to $8,000+. It's important to get a detailed, in-person assessment from a local contractor, as older homes in the area may have unique needs that affect the final price.

3When is the best time of year to get insulation installed in Clarksville?

While insulation can be installed year-round, the ideal times are late spring (May-June) and early fall (September-October). These periods typically offer mild, dry weather in Iowa, which is optimal for contractor availability and for work like attic installations. Avoid the peak of winter when attic work can be hazardous and the height of summer when extreme heat makes attic work unbearable.

4Are there any local rebates or incentives for insulation upgrades in Iowa?

Yes, Iowa homeowners should explore two primary programs. MidAmerican Energy offers rebates for adding insulation to attics, walls, and basements. More significantly, the federal Inflation Reduction Act provides tax credits for qualified insulation improvements. A reputable local installer will be familiar with these programs and can help guide you through the paperwork.

5What should I look for when choosing an insulation contractor in Butler County?

Prioritize licensed, insured, and locally established contractors with strong references in the Clarksville/Butler County area. They should perform a thorough energy audit or assessment before quoting. Ensure they understand Iowa's building codes and climate-specific needs, and ask if they handle necessary air sealing—a critical step often overlooked that dramatically improves insulation performance.
